# pyqt

A quantum transport library based on the non equilibrium Green’s function (NEGF) formalism written in Python.

## Getting Started

These instructions will get you a copy of the project up and running on your local machine for development and testing purposes. See deployment for notes on how to deploy the project on a live system.

### Prerequisites

> Ase https://wiki.fysik.dtu.dk/ase/ > numpy https://github.com/numpy

### Installing

pip install qtpyt

## Running the tests

pytest subfolder/tests
